ABSTRACT
This work had as objective to evaluate litter deposition in two secondary semideciduous forest areas: Medium Status Forest (MSF) and Advanced Status Forest (ASF), located in Pinheiral county, Rio de Janeiro, Brazil. For litter deposition evaluation, in each area were set 10 litter traps in the beginning of 1998. The material was dried in an oven (65°C ± 5) and separated in leaves, branches, flowers, fruits, rinds and others. The MSF area showed higher litter deposition variation in relation to ASF area. In the MSF area the highest litter value was 13.14 t ha-1 and 9.40 t ha-1 the lowest.
